工作流高级事务模型ESaga的实现与验证  

Implementation and Verification of An Advanced Transaction Model ESaga Based on Agent in the Workflow System

在线阅读下载全文

作  者:丁月华[1] 

机构地区:[1]内蒙古大学数学科学学院,呼和浩特010021

出  处:《内蒙古大学学报(自然科学版)》2012年第6期645-651,共7页Journal of Inner Mongolia University:Natural Science Edition

基  金:内蒙古大学青年科学基金资助项目(ND0812)

摘  要:对传统高级事务模型Saga进行扩展和改进的高级事务模型ESaga,建立在CORBA对象事务服务模型(OTS)基础之上.不仅为Saga模型增加了分布式事务支持,而且应用多A-gent技术进行优化,很大程度上弥补了Saga模型补偿事务过于复杂的不足,使Saga模型能够应用到现实工作流系统中解决长事务问题.现给出与ESaga模型实现相关的平台,长事务处理接口定义,事务Agent的部分定义、算法,及其验证结果.An Long Lived Transaction(LLT)Esaga model which based on traditional LLT Saga model is built on the basis of Object Transaction Service of CORBA.ESaga enhanced the distributed transaction support for Saga,and optimized Saga by Agent technology.The improvements covered the shortage of Saga whose compensation affairs are too complex and made Saga model can be applied to a real workflow system to solve LLT problems.An implementation platform of ESaga,the processing interface,part of the Agent definition and algorithm of LLT Esaga model are given.Finally,the validation results of LLT Esaga model are provided.

关 键 词:工作流 长事务 SAGA AGENT ESaga 

分 类 号:TP311.52[自动化与计算机技术—计算机软件与理论]

 

参考文献:

正在载入数据...

 

二级参考文献:

正在载入数据...

 

耦合文献:

正在载入数据...

 

引证文献:

正在载入数据...

 

二级引证文献:

正在载入数据...

 

同被引文献:

正在载入数据...

 

相关期刊文献:

正在载入数据...

相关的主题
相关的作者对象
相关的机构对象